TRIADS OF BARDISM.

1. God made the world of three substances: fire; nature; and finiteness.

2. The three instrumentalities of God in making the world: will; wisdom; and love.

3. The three principal occupations of God: to enlighten the darkness; to give a body to nonentity; and to animate the dead.

4. Three things which God cannot be: unskilful; unjust; and unmerciful.

5. Three things required by God of man: firm belief, that is, faith; religious obedience; and to do justice.

6. The three principal temperaments of life: strength; vigour; and perception.

7. The three principal properties of life: temper; motion; and light.
